January - Begins filming "Black Dawn", location unknown, studio unknown (source: suziwong, from the Northwest Herald, December 30, 2004).

Plot: He's playing a former CIA operative who has been framed for killing so many fellow agents, he's become the object of a shoot-on-sight directive. And as if that weren't enough to keep him busy, he's happened onto a deal between Colombian arms dealers and Middle Eastern terrorists who want plutonium for a suitcase bomb to blow L.A. to smithereens.

Family Room Entertainment Project Status Report

LOS ANGELES--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Sept. 29, 2004--Emmett/Furla Films, a wholly owned subsidiary of Family Room Entertainment Corporation (OTCBB:FMLY), would like to give a status report on projects that are in development and/or slated for production in fiscal year 2005.

The following projects are in active production or are slated to be in active production during the calendar year 2004:

-- "SUBMERGED," starring Steven Seagal, has completed principal photography and is now in post-production.

-- "MERCENARY," which stars Steven Seagal, is scheduled to begin filming on February 1st, 2005
